If you're a cheese lover like me, making Brazilian cheese bread or Pão de Queijo at home is a delightful experience. What I appreciate most about this recipe is how it uses simple ingredients like tapioca flour, cheese, eggs, and milk, which combine to create a bread that's uniquely chewy and airy. One tip I found helpful is to use a good quality cheese, such as Parmesan or mozzarella, to get that perfect cheesy flavor. When preparing the dough, it’s important to ensure the milk and oil are hot before mixing with the tapioca flour; this helps achieve the characteristic texture that makes these small rolls puff up beautifully. I like to bake them until they have a golden crust but remain soft inside—ideal for dipping into coffee or even enjoying on their own. Another thing I love about Pão de Queijo is its versatility. Though traditionally a snack or breakfast item in Brazil, these cheese breads can easily become part of a lunchbox or party platter. They are gluten-free due to the tapioca flour base, which is great for those with gluten sensitivities.
